Lay a crushed stone base Our experts prefer crushed stone for the base rather than naturally occurring gravel dug from a pit Crushed stone is a little more expensive However, it provides better drainage, and because of the sharper angles on the stone, it requires less compacting, and once it’s compacted, it stays that way.

Crushed Stone Patio Base Crushed stone is one of the most reliable base materials you can use under a patio surface of pavers or slabs Dig a patio base 10 inches below grade and lay a flat base of 2 inches of sand After leveling, place sheets of erosion-reducing fabric over the sand Place a 6-inch depth of crushed stone on the fabric.

Selecting crushed stone for a shed base The stone to be used for constructing the storage shed foundations should be what is known as 'well graded material' This means that there is a good mix of stone sizes from about 40mm diameter down to very fine dust The best material for this in the UK is sold as Department of Transport Type 1.

There are a few different methods for leveling a surface of crushed stone or gravel for a patio, whether the stone will become the surface material or a base layer for other paving materials If the patio is small--8 or 10 feet--you can simply tape a 4-foot level to the top edge of a straight 8- or 10-foot 2 by 4 and use it to check the surface.

If you try to compact 6” of base, you will only compact the top 4” and the bottom 2” will settle in the future You must compact your base in layers of 3″ - 4″ If you’ve decided on a 6” base, you’ll want to fill and compact your base in multiple phas If your base materials are dry, don’t be afraid to add a little water.

Nov 24, 2015· Along the sides, the slope of the gravel from the top of the pad down to the ground should be at least 2 to 1: for every two feet of height of compactable gravel, the bottom of the gravel should extend 1 foot past the top But again, because of the possibility of erosion, we don’t recommend building a free form gravel base on a slope).
